Podcast Overview

People of Color are underrepresented in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ics (STEM) fields in the United States. With all odds against us, it is hard to excel and seek motivation in a field where we are always the minority. The Win in STEM Podcast will be a platform to highlight successful people of color “STEMinists” to show how you can get a seat at the table and WIN IN STEM!! Breaking Barriers in STEM: STEMNoire

<p>Imagine walking into a lab, classroom, or a meeting, and being the only Black woman in the room. This is a reality for many of us in the field of STEM. Currently, only 2% of STEM jobs are held by Black women. Unfortunately, some of us end up leaving due to feelings of isolation, mistreatment, and a lack of opportunities. However, there are organizations working tirelessly to change this narrative.</p> <p><br>Meet Dr. Kilan Ashad-Bishop and Teressa Alexander, the co-founders of STEMNoire ! After a fateful phone conversation in 2019, they founded STEMNoire and began recruiting a team of Black women in STEM to build a community for us, by us. Since then, STEMNoire has grown into a global research and wellness community that convenes Black women and non-binary people in STEM to foster community, facilitate collaboration, and enhance personal and professional outcomes. STEMNoire hosts an annual conference where attendees across the globe are able to leave with targeted personal and professional development resources necessary for resilience in STEM education and the workforce.</p> <p><br>Tune in to learn more about why STEMNoire was created, how to join, and details on their upcoming conference!! Breaking Barriers in STEM: LIV Consulting & Career Services

<p>We’re back with another episode and this one is for my Public Health folks!!</p> <p><br>Meet Olivia Umoren, MPH, Founder and CEO of LIV Consulting &amp; Career Services. LIV Consulting &amp; Career Services supports high school students to executive-level professionals in achieving their career goals in Public Health and Health Policy. Olivia launched her business in June 2021 after observing a major need for career support and guidance among public health students and graduates. Many of her former classmates shared common sentiments of their undergraduate and graduate programs not preparing them for the competitive workforce post-graduation. Since 2021, LIV Consulting &amp; Career Services has grown to a following of 5,000+ professionals on LinkedIn and has served over 180 clients from students to established professionals.</p> <p> Interested in the services LIV Consulting &amp; Career Services has to offer?
